Hanau sits on the Main River just east of Frankfurt and serves as a compact gateway to the Rhine-Main region. The town preserves a charming historic core with half-timbered houses, markets, and riverside walks. It is known as the birthplace of the Brothers Grimm, who inspired museums and literary sites in town.
With easy rail links to Frankfurt and a welcoming Hessian atmosphere, Hanau is ideal for a short city break or a nature-infused day trip.

How to Behave
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ior
Be on time for appointments; use the Sie form in formal settings and greet with a handshake.
Quiet conversation in public spaces is appreciated; queue politely and follow local etiquette in shops and venues.

Tipping in Hanau
Ensure a smooth experience
Rounding up the bill or leaving 5-10% is customary in restaurants and cafés.
Cash (Euro) and cards (EC/Mastercard/Visa) are widely accepted; contactless payments are common.
